Doesn’t this photo give you the biggest smile?!?

This moment almost didn’t happen!!

This sweet girl wanted absolutely nothing to do with photos with her dad. We gave her space, and followed her lead. No forcing. Just patience.

And then, right at the very end, she ran straight into his arms for hugs, kisses, and the biggest belly laughs. 💛

As a photographer, I’ve learned that patience is often more important than posing. Children don’t work on our timeline, they work on theirs.
One thing 22 years of photographing families has taught me is this: children don’t need direction nearly as much as they need time.

Those are the moments I’m waiting for.

The moments that can’t be forced, only patiently waited for. 🤍

In-home newborn sessions are never rushed over here 🤍

We move entirely at your baby’s pace.
That means time for feeding, cuddles, diaper changes, snack breaks for siblings, and all the little pauses in between ✨

These sessions are designed to feel calm, cozy, and gentle, so you can actually enjoy the experience while I document this season exactly as it is 🥹
